2026-27 Cali Artist-in-Residence: Gabriel Kahane

Composer, singer-songwriter, conductor, and theater artist Gabriel Kahane joins Cali as the 2026–27 Artist-in-Residence. Known for crossing boundaries between classical music, songwriting, and theater, Kahane brings a distinctive and wide-ranging artistic voice to the Cali community through performances, conversations, and student collaborations.

Performing Ensembles

Performance is at the heart of the Cali School experience. Across every program, students have regular opportunities to perform, collaborate, and grow as artists. Each year, Cali presents more than 300 concerts, recitals, masterclasses, and special events featuring students, faculty, ensembles, and guest artists.

Students perform in many settings, from solo and chamber recitals to jazz combos, opera productions, choirs, orchestras, bands, percussion ensembles, contemporary music projects, and large collaborative concerts. Annual events such as Kaleidoscope bring together soloists and ensembles of all sizes in performances that span many styles and traditions.

Large ensemble and opera performances are held in the Alexander Kasser Theater, while solo recitals, jazz performances, chamber music, guest artist events, and other Cali concerts take place in the Jed Leshowitz Recital Hall and performance spaces across campus.
